Common Side Effects
The most common side effects of niacin flushing are a red skin. This happens because when you take in an overdose of vitamin b3, more blood will flow through the capillaries. These capillaries can be seen as access roads, if the veins were a highway. The capillaries often are located very close to the skin.

Another annoying side effect is the feeling that you have endured and intense sunburn or a tingling feeling in some parts of the body. This is your body ‘flushing’ the system, getting rid of waste stored in the fatty tissues.
Other side effects that could occur are:
  • Headaches
  • Stomach ache
  • General uncomfortable feelings
